Cougars Fall in Series Finale to Sonoma State

SAN MARCOS, Calif. – A big inning by Sonoma State (16-21, 13-15 CCAA) was the difference as the Cal State San Marcos baseball team (13-25, 9-19 CCAA) fell 14-7 in the series finale on Saturday at CSUSM Baseball Field.

TOP PERFORMERS
Aiden Richert – 2-for-4 | 3 RBIs | 1 2B | 1 SAC | 1 SB
Kevin Van Linge – 2-for-3 | 2 RBIs | 1 R | 1 SF | 1 HBP
Pat MacDonald Jr. – 3-for-5 | 1 R | 1 2B
Ethan Rivera – 2-for-4 | 3 R | 1 BB
Emilio Luna – 2-for-4 | 1 RBI | 1 R | 1 BB

HOW IT HAPPENED
  • CSUSM got the scoring started in the bottom of the second inning on a two-out RBI single by Luna and an RBI single up the middle by Griffin Teisher to put the Cougars up 2-0.
  • SSU tied the game in the top of the third inning with a one-out two-run double to left center by Josh Medina.
  • The Cougars retook the lead at 3-2 in the bottom of the third with a sac fly to center by Van Linge. Rivera scored all the way from second after the SSU catcher dropped the ball attempting to apply the tag at the plate.
  • The Seawolves knotted the game at 3-all in the top of the fifth on a bases-loaded sac fly to center by Medina that scored Lucas Townsend.
  • CSUSM went up 5-3 in the bottom of the fifth as Van Linge was hit by a pitch with the bases loaded followed by an RBI groundout to second by Richert.
  • SSU posted an eight-run inning in the top of the sixth to go up 11-5 on seven hits, one error, a walk and a hit-by-pitch.
  • Following a leadoff single by Josh Lopez in the top of the eighth, Cole Brodnansky hit a two-run blast to left center and put the Seawolves up 13-5.
  • A leadoff homer by SSU's Otis Statum put the Seawolves ahead 14-5 in the top of the ninth.
  • After two walks and a single loaded the bases in the bottom of the ninth, Richert hit a ground-rule double over the left field wall to plate Stanford and Rivera. The Cougars then struck out twice and grounded out to first to end the game.
 
QUICK HITS
  • SSU reliever Niko Tejada (1-0) earned the win after allowing just two walks, one hit and one hit-by-pitch in 2.0 innings.
  • CSUSM reliever Zack Jordan (0-2) took the loss after allowing five runs (four earned) on three hits, two walks and a hit-by-pitch while striking out two in 2.0 innings.
  • Luke Reece extended his hitting streak to 12 games – the longest by a Cougar this season.
  • Rivera tallied his 16th multi-hit game of the season and his 10th game with two hits.
